The PAC-12 is divided into 2 different divisions, the south and the north. Here are a list of the schools in the corresponding division.

South:

Arizona

Arizone State

Colorado

UCLA

USC

Utah

North:

Cal

Oregon

Oregon State

Stanford

Washington

Washington state

What year did the Big 12 form?

The conference was officially formed on February 25, 1994, when the former Big Eight Conference merged with four Texas schools that had been members of the Southwest Conference, which had just disbanded. Athletic competition in the conference commenced on August 31, 1996.
